Output e32f84fe80ac2ea836c1baf06265cbfcb0e07e6879fdba9752ed3e608da8c8ee:1

value
12699222
script pubkey
OP_0 OP_PUSHBYTES_20 d3d2aefd573859a6717c87885394d4b10ca74db6
address
bc1q60f2al2h8pv6vutus7y989x5kyx2wndkn57s2d
transaction
e32f84fe80ac2ea836c1baf06265cbfcb0e07e6879fdba9752ed3e608da8c8ee
spent
true